Trump Truth Social is Merging with TAE Technologies Nuclear Fusion

Trump Media & Technology Group (TMTG), the parent company of Truth Social and ticker DJT, has announced a definitive agreement to merge with TAE Technologies, a leading private nuclear fusion energy company, in an all-stock transaction valued at more than $6 billion.Key details of the merger:This creates one of the world’s first publicly traded nuclear fusion companies.

Shareholders of TMTG and TAE will each own approximately 50% of the combined entity on a fully diluted basis.

The deal is expected to close in mid-2026, pending regulatory and shareholder approvals.

TMTG will serve as the holding company, encompassing Truth Social, its financial ventures (like Truth.Fi), and TAE’s operations, including TAE Power Solutions (energy storage for EVs) and TAE Life Sciences (cancer treatments).

Leadership: Devin Nunes (current TMTG CEO) and Michl Binderbauer (TAE CEO) will become co-CEOs. Donald Trump Jr. will join the board.

TMTG commits up to $200–300 million in cash to TAE to accelerate development.

They begin construction in 2026 on the world’s first utility-scale fusion power plant (initially ~50 MWe), with future plants targeting 350–500 MWe, aimed at providing abundant clean energy for AI data centers, national defense, and energy independence.

TAE Technologies’ current demonstrations focus on their research reactors, particularly the Norman (operated until ~2022, achieving stable plasma at over 75 million °C) and the newer Norm (introduced in 2025).

Norm represents their latest breakthrough. It produces stable, fusion-relevant plasma using only neutral beam injection (NBI), eliminating complex formation hardware. This simplifies the design (reducing length/complexity by ~50%), improves efficiency, and sustains high-performance steady-state plasmas at temperatures exceeding 70-75 million °C (with upgrades targeting 100 million °C).

Specific figures for fusion power output in these demos are low (research-scale, not net-positive yet). No public exact values for the Lawson triple product (nτT, where n = density, τ = confinement time, T = temperature) are widely reported for Norm/Norman, but performance supports scaling to reactor conditions. They have demonstrated p-¹¹B fusion reactions (though minimal yield) and high stability.

For commercialization (2026–2030 and beyond)
A major 2025 breakthrough with Norm allowed TAE to shorten their roadmap, skipping the planned Copernicus reactor (originally for net energy demonstration by late 2020s). Starting in 2026, the combined company plans to site and begin construction on the world’s first utility-scale fusion power plant — initially a ~50 MWe facility, with follow-on plants scaling to 350–500 MWe.

The prototype commercial power plant, Da Vinci, targets operation in the early 2030s to demonstrate net energy (Q > 1) and grid-connected electricity using hydrogen-boron (p-¹¹B) fuel for clean, aneutronic fusion.

Commercial hydrogen-boron fusion power delivery to the grid in the early 2030s, with modular, compact reactors designed for cost-competitiveness and applications like AI data centers.

TAE Technologies’ Field-Reversed Configuration (FRC) Fusion Approach

TAE Technologies’ fusion research centers on an advanced beam-driven Field-Reversed Configuration (FRC), a magnetic confinement method that forms a compact, self-stable plasma structure resembling a smoke ring or elongated toroid (often described as cigar-shaped).

In a standard FRC, the plasma generates its own internal magnetic field through toroidal currents, reversing the direction of an externally applied axial magnetic field. This creates closed magnetic field lines inside the plasma (confining it) while open lines exist outside, with minimal magnetic field in the core—resulting in very high beta (ratio of plasma pressure to magnetic pressure, often near 1).This self-organization reduces the need for complex, powerful external magnets compared to tokamaks, enabling a simpler linear (cylindrical) reactor design that’s easier and cheaper to build, maintain, and scale.

Historically, FRCs offered high potential power density and simplicity but suffered from instabilities and short confinement times. TAE overcomes this by integrating plasma physics with accelerator physics: High-energy neutral particle beams (from proprietary accelerators) are injected tangentially into the plasma. These beams drive current, heat the plasma, fuel it, and actively stabilize it through real-time feedback controls.

A 2025 breakthrough in TAE’s Norm machine (an upgrade from the previous Norman reactor) demonstrated FRC formation using only neutral beam injection (NBI)—eliminating traditional complex formation hardware like theta-pinch coils and plasma collisions. This simplifies the design by ~50%, reduces cost/complexity, and produces stable, high-performance plasmas at fusion-relevant temperatures (>70-75 million °C, with paths to higher).

Key Advantages of TAE’s FRC

Compact and efficient — Linear geometry, fewer magnets, potential for 100x more fusion power output than a comparable tokamak (same field strength/volume).

High stability– Beams suppress instabilities; plasmas become more stable at higher temperatures (like a spinning top).

Versatile fuels– Works with multiple cycles, but optimized for hydrogen-boron (p-¹¹B)—an aneutronic reaction producing three helium-4 (alpha) particles and energy, with no neutrons. This avoids radioactivity, structural damage, and complex thermal cycles (direct energy conversion possible via charged particles).

Cleanest option– Abundant fuels (hydrogen and boron are common), no long-lived waste, ideal for sustainable baseload power.
